Psychiatrists

It is essential to seek assistance as soon as you can if you are suffering from mental health issues. Your GP may refer you to a psychiatrist following an initial appointment. These medical professionals have special training in diagnosing and treating mental disorders. They can also prescribe medications to treat your symptoms. They can also work with psychotherapists to develop an treatment plan that incorporates therapy and medication.

It is crucial to select a psychiatrist with excellent communication skills. This could include being an excellent listener, recognizing non-verbal signals and asking relevant questions. In addition, they should be able to convey complicated medical information in a way that patients are able to get more info comprehend. You can also find out how good a psychiatrist by reading reviews on the internet. You should be aware that negative reviews may be written for a variety of reasons.

Many people have a hard time finding a psychiatrist who accepts their insurance. There are, however, some alternatives for those who don't have health insurance or cannot afford the all the cost. Health centers that are part of the safety net or comprehensive centers usually have psychiatrists on staff and offer low-cost or even free services. There are many providers that offer sliding-scale rates for clients who are not insured.

Psychiatrists are doctors who have one of two medical degrees Doctor of Medicine (MD) or doctor of Osteopathic Medicine (DO). They are trained to diagnose and treating psychological disorders like depression, bipolar disorder, and anxiety. They can prescribe medication to help you conquer these conditions.

Psychologists and counselors are competent to treat certain symptoms but they are unable to prescribe medication. They need to collaborate with a psychiatrist to create a treatment program that includes both psychotherapy and medication. Counsellors

Counselors offer guidance and support to families, individuals or groups facing emotional, social, or personal challenges. They employ a variety of methods to help people process their feelings and find healthy solution to problems. Their role is to identify the root of the problem as well as providing insight into the relationships and behavior and facilitating the development of healthy ways of coping. They may also suggest alternative options or refer people to medical professionals. Counselors usually work in private practices and mental health clinics. They also are employed in hospitals and schools.

A counselor's role is to provide a safe and comfortable space for people to talk about their issues. They can help people with various issues such as anxiety, stress depression, addictions, and anxiety. They can assist with overcoming trauma and abuse in childhood. Unlike psychiatrists, they don't prescribe medications. Counselors can help you cope with these problems by providing a safe listening environment. They can also assist you in developing an active and healthy lifestyle.

Therapists can provide group sessions as well as individual counseling. This allows you to meet with other people who are experiencing similar struggles, and can help build an emotional support system. If you aren't sure if group therapy is the right option for you, it's an excellent idea to speak with a counselor or therapist about your options.

Check if the counselor you are considering is a member of British Association for Counselling and Psychotherapy. Counsellors who are BACP-accredited have been trained to perform their work at a professional level. They must be supervised by a certified practitioner when working with clients.
